Does this guy really think this is my true strength? The Railgun is just the most straightforward and efficient way I use my power.
Misaka Mikoto held a game coin between her fingers. With a light flick, it shot upward with a metallic clang. The coin spun midair before naturally returning to her thumb. This was simple electromagnetic control, something that required almost no effort for her. Of course, if she got distracted, she might forget to use magnetism properly.
Judging from his expression, he clearly wasn't taking this seriously.
"They're coming."
Arata's heart tightened as his pupils glowed faintly red. His ability allowed him to perceive events two seconds into the future. The Railgun wasn't aimed at him. It would only graze past.
In other words, Misaka Mikoto had never truly intended to hit anyone with the Railgun, and she never would.
It always feels like I'm bullying someone.
The thought had barely formed when an orange-yellow beam, like a blazing spear, shot past him. Because it exceeded three times the speed of sound, the explosive boom followed a moment later.
The scorching blast slammed into the esper barrier, producing a sharp, grating screech. The airflow generated by the Railgun was comparable to that of a powerful Level 4 Aero Hand user.
The ground trembled as the stands behind him took damage. Wherever the beam passed, the rubberized surface had already begun to melt at over 720 degrees Celsius, releasing a harsh, burnt smell.
"..." Uiharu Kazari stared at the scene in stunned silence.
"Railgun. This is Onee-sama's ultimate move. No one in Academy City can withstand it. That gorilla is probably too shocked to react." Shirai Kuroko said proudly, peeking at her stunned friend with one eye half-open.
This was Tokiwadai Middle School's ace.
The one and only Railgun.
"What an incredible attack. My blood's actually boiling. My pride won't let me sit this out." Sogiita Gunha muttered with his arms crossed. After spending so long in Academy City, this was the first time he had encountered another Level 5 with such overwhelming presence.
"The Third Ranked Level 5, Railgun. And the Eighth is telekinesis, just like mine."
"But… what do we do about this?" Shirai Kuroko glanced at the damaged stadium floor and instinctively covered her cheek, looking troubled. Even with the privileges granted to a Level 5, causing this kind of destruction to public facilities would definitely result in disciplinary action.
"So this is the Railgun. Launching a coin at over three times the speed of sound. The power isn't bad. Think you can handle being hit by one?"
Seeing Arata standing still, Misaka Mikoto assumed he was intimidated. She casually pulled another coin from her pocket and spoke with relaxed confidence.
"Hmm." Arata stroked his chin and smiled faintly. "I didn't dodge because you weren't aiming at me in the first place."
"Oh? So you think you can dodge it? Hehe, you'll regret showing off like that." Misaka Mikoto replied, firing another Railgun. This time, the orange beam was aimed directly at his side.
Arata raised his hand and casually slapped toward it.
In that instant, his ability activated.
The orange beam reversed at its original velocity, vanishing in the blink of an eye.
"Clang!"
A coin dropped to the ground at Misaka Mikoto's feet.
She froze.
Where's my Railgun?
Her gaze fell slowly to the coin.
"Huh?" Sogiita Gunha rubbed his eyes in disbelief. What just happened? His vision hadn't even kept up. Misaka Mikoto's Railgun had simply vanished. Was it neutralized?
"How is that possible?" Shirai Kuroko shouted, as if she had just seen something impossible. "Onee-sama's Railgun disappeared? That ape just… erased it with his hand? That makes no sense!"
"Ah" Uiharu gasped, her mouth hanging open. Everything she thought she understood about esper abilities had just been overturned.
"What did you do? My Railgun just… disappeared!" Misaka Mikoto demanded, staring at Arata as her thoughts spiraled.
"Why not fire again and watch carefully this time?" Arata said with a faint smile.
Misaka Mikoto's expression turned serious. Her pride as a Level 5 wouldn't allow her to accept that someone had just nullified her Railgun so casually.
Clang.
Another coin launched forward, transforming into a blazing orange beam aimed directly at Arata.
He smiled lightly and repeated the same motion, casually slapping at the incoming attack.
To him alone, the flow of time became visible.
The moment his ability took effect, the beam began to rewind, returning to its state from three seconds earlier.
Clang!
The sound of a coin hitting the ground echoed again.
Misaka Mikoto stared at the empty space in front of her, then at Arata, who still held his hand out as if he had just struck something.
"How… is this possible? What just happened?" she exclaimed, her usual confidence completely gone as she looked at the second coin at her feet.
Is this the same coin I just fired?
What is going on?
The boy rubbed his eyes again, harder this time. He hadn't seen it clearly the first time, and the second time was no better. All he caught was the orange beam suddenly reversing, followed by the coin dropping.
"It disappeared again… what is happening?" Shirai Kuroko muttered, biting her thumb in frustration.
Index sat quietly in the audience, blinking in confusion. She didn't understand esper abilities at all, and even after watching, she still didn't.
"What's wrong with all of you? That tea-haired girl's attack just got erased by Arata, right? Why are you all acting like it's impossible?"
"It's impossible because it's Onee-sama's Railgun!" Shirai Kuroko snapped. "What's your relationship with that guy? Do you know what he did?"
"Arata? My relationship with Arata…" Index tilted her head, thinking. "He saved me, so he should feed me and give me a place to stay, right?"
"What the hell just happened? What did you do?" Misaka Mikoto pointed at Arata, her voice rising. For the first time, there was clear panic in her tone. Her invincible Railgun had vanished without a trace.
"Where did it go? Heh." Arata narrowed his eyes as he slowly approached her, a teasing smile forming. At some point, he had started enjoying this. Watching Misaka Mikoto lose her composure was unexpectedly entertaining.
It was probably a side effect of "Words of Infinite Deception".
"Misaka-senpai… are you curious about what just happened?"
